bulk_mark_incomplete_operations_as_failed
bulk_mark_incomplete_operations_as_failed is a Magento 2 cron job declared by the AsynchronousOperations module in the Default group. It runs every 10 minutes (*/10 * * * *) and dispatches Magento\AsynchronousOperations\Cron\MarkIncompleteOperationsAsFailed::execute() on every tick.
Wiring
- Group
- Default (default)
- Module
- AsynchronousOperations (magento/module-asynchronous-operations)
- Schedule
- */10 * * * *
- Frequency
- every 10 minutes
- Handler
- Magento\AsynchronousOperations\Cron\MarkIncompleteOperationsAsFailed::execute()
- Source file
- vendor/magento/module-asynchronous-operations/etc/crontab.xml
Run the bulk_mark_incomplete_operations_as_failed cron job manually
Magento doesn't have a per-job CLI invocation — the smallest unit is a group. The command below runs every job in the default group whose schedule is due. The --bootstrap flag bypasses the lock-file check so the job runs even when the system cron is configured.
php bin/magento cron:run --group=default --bootstrap=standaloneProcessStarted=1Define your own job like this one
Want a job that fires on the same cadence in your own module? Drop these two files in — adjust the vendor/module namespace, the job name, and the body of execute.
1. etc/crontab.xml
<?xml version="1.0"?>
<config xmlns:xsi="http://www.w3.org/2001/XMLSchema-instance"
xsi:noNamespaceSchemaLocation="urn:magento:module:Magento_Cron:etc/crontab.xsd">
<group id="default">
<job name="vendor_module_bulk_mark_incomplete_operations_as_failed_clone"
instance="Vendor\Module\Cron\BulkMarkIncompleteOperationsAsFailed"
method="execute">
<schedule>*/10 * * * *</schedule>
</job>
</group>
</config>2. Cron handler class
<?php
declare(strict_types=1);
namespace Vendor\Module\Cron;
use Psr\Log\LoggerInterface;
class BulkMarkIncompleteOperationsAsFailed
{
public function __construct(
private readonly LoggerInterface $logger,
) {
}
public function execute(): void
{
$this->logger->info('bulk_mark_incomplete_operations_as_failed cron tick');
// Your scheduled work here. Keep this short — long jobs
// should enqueue work onto the message queue rather than
// running inline in the cron tick.
}
